Hello, I am Byebyefish, a French artist from Garches near Paris. I explore two main musical styles: Neoclassical Piano and Indie Rock.
In the early 2000’s I started to compose piano short pieces inspired by classical masters such as Claude Debussy, Maurice Ravel or Erik Satie and by musicians like Yann Tiersen. Some other piano-vocal songs followed from 2007. Then I recorded a lullabies album dedicated to my newborn daughter Lucie in 2011, trying to reach melodic, blissful, and streamlined piano pieces.
I was a member of Tiret Project (French/Australian Indie Rock, 2013-2015) and Emo Echo (French Indie Pop, 2015-2017). These two bands were a good opportunity to experience new keyboard sounds or effects.
Shortly after, I started composing Indie Folk guitar songs (inspired by many references including Radiohead, The National, Grizzly Bear or Kings of Convenience) writing and singing most of lyrics in French. My LP conceptual album about couple crises ‘De pénombres en lumières’ (From shade to light) has been released in January 2020, receiving very good feedback from international medias and listeners.
Since 2021, I have released several new neoclassical solo piano singles. The pieces combine melancholic, relaxing and romantic moods, with deeply expressive composition and playing. ‘First Breaths’ (out on February 3rd, 2023) is the latest single.
